Is React Native a Good Choice for Your Mobile App Development Project?

Prabin Samuel
4 min readDec 16, 2020

--

Mobile apps are ruling the world in 2020.

It is to be noted that a person uses mobile apps on an average of 3–4 hours a day, that is equal to 45 days a year.

This is a massive chance to leverage if you are a business owner.

According to TechCrunch, Global App revenue jumped to $50B in the first half of 2020.

Nowadays, every business owns a mobile app.

Starting from grocery to clothing business, everybody uses mobile apps to stay connected with customers.

Besides they also use mobile apps as a tool to promote their business and brand.

If you are a business owner that does not have a mobile app, start it today with the Best Mobile App Development Company.

Mobile App Development

Mobile app development has become simple now.

Product owners have a lot of choices if they want to deliver a great mobile experience to users.

Building a native app is not the only option.

They can rely on web technologies, browser rendering and go hybrid or build native-like apps using cross-platform tools like React Native/ Flutter.

3 Types of Mobile App Development

Here are the three common types of mobile app development.

  • Native App Development
  • Hybrid App Development
  • Cross-platform App Development

Cross-platform App Development

App development approach in cross-platform uses native rendering engine.

Besides, the so-called bridges allow the codebase written in JS to connect with the native components.

This is the primary reason why cross-platforms apps offer close-to-native UX.

Here are the most common tools used to build cross-platform mobile apps.

  • React Native
  • Xamarin
  • Flutter

React Native App Development

React Native is an open-source framework for mobile app development.

It offers faster and low-cost mobile apps in a short development time.

React Native is based on JS and React.

As the tool is maintained by Facebook, it offers many advantages to developers.

This is a prime reason why you should hire react native app developers to leverage all the advantages and build your mobile app.

Also, React Native utilizes multiple UI blocks to develop apps for Android and iOS using a common language — JavaScript.

Thus many business owners leverage React Native for its flexibility, scalability and cost-effectiveness.

Besides, many enterprises have started following the React Native App Development trends to succeed in 2021.

Is React Native the Right Choice for Mobile App Development

Yes, if you are perfect mobile app development, React Native is the right choice.

Besides its low cost, there are many features that make you feel that React Native is the right technology for your mobile app.

Here are a few highlights;

Cross-platform

As discussed above, React Native offers cross-platform compatibility.

When React Native was introduced, it was only used for iOS.

But considering its features, it was further expanded to Android as well.

If you want a mobile app, all you should do is hire a React Native developer who is expert in JavaScript.

Faster Development

React Native helps developers to build mobile apps much faster.

As it is an open-source JS framework, it has various components that can be used locally.

This makes the developers work faster and save 30% of development time.

As React Native offers hot reload, React Native developers can change codes in real-time.

Cost-effective Solution

If you are a start-up or an SMB, React Native is the right solution for you.

Besides React Native helps you achieve optimal results and complete project in a short time at a low cost.

The simple codes and UI libraries are the prime reason.

Also, when you hire dedicated react native developer, you can save up to 30% of time and cost.

Developer Experience

The development environment in React Native offers a positive experience for developers.

It allows React Native developer skills to be used to maximum potential.

Also, the hot reloading allows developers to make changes in real-time.

The flexbox layout engine in React Native generates pp layout that allows you to learn just one layout engine to process development on both iOS and Android platforms.

Thus developers as a whole feel better when they work on mobile apps with React Native.

Final Thoughts

Now you know that React Native is the best tech for cross-platform mobile app development, it is up to you to leverage and elevate your business.

Firstly, start from finding the best react native development company like Soft Suave.

Secondly, hire the best React Native Developers in India by using a free 1-week trial.

Thirdly, share your needs and start development.

Finally, deploy the mobile app on both iOS and Android platform under your budget in a short time.

--

--

Prabin Samuel

Prabin is a success driven content writer and passionate digital marketer having expertise skill sets in research. He’s a creative thinker and loves to explore.